Glass Thickness Variations

The thickness of the glass is an important specification that affects both the strength and weight of the table top. Typically, work station table glass thickness ranges from 6mm to 12mm. A thickness of 6-8mm is generally suitable for light use, while 10-12mm is recommended for a more robust application, particularly in environments where the workstation will experience heavier loads or frequent use.

Optimal Size Considerations

Another key aspect of work station table glass is its size. The dimensions should be tailored to fit the specific workspace requirements, primarily depending on the available area and intended use. Common sizes for glass tops can vary broadly, with lengths typically ranging from 120cm to 180cm and widths from 60cm to 90cm. It’s essential to measure your workstation accurately to ensure a perfect fit, both for practical use and for maintaining a sleek, professional appearance.
